Old vintage carved wood granary ladder used by the Dogon people of Mali to access upper levels of storage areas or flat rooftops. Hand carved steps with Y shaped top section were useful in everyday life. Agriculture is an essential part of Dogon life and these ladders are a personal belonging tool used to store grains up high for protection from rodents, thieves, and humidity. he granary ladder also serves as a symbol of wealth and power status of owner.
